How can I create a cozy atmosphere in my moody farmhouse kitchen?

As a homeowner who loves the rustic charm of farmhouse decor, creating a cozy atmosphere in my kitchen is a top priority. I want my kitchen to feel warm, inviting, and full of character. Here are some tips and ideas on how to achieve that cozy vibe in a moody farmhouse kitchen.

1. What color scheme should I choose to enhance the coziness of my farmhouse kitchen?

When it comes to creating a cozy atmosphere, the color scheme plays a significant role. For a moody farmhouse kitchen, I recommend opting for warm, earthy tones like deep greens, rich browns, and dark grays. These colors can help create a sense of intimacy and warmth in the space. Pairing these shades with lighter neutrals like cream or beige can balance out the darkness and add a touch of brightness.

2. Are there specific lighting fixtures that can help create a warm and inviting ambiance in my kitchen?

To enhance the coziness of my farmhouse kitchen, I prefer using warm, soft lighting fixtures. Pendant lights with dimmable bulbs can create a soft, ambient glow, perfect for setting a cozy mood. I also like to incorporate sconces or under-cabinet lighting to add depth and warmth to the space. Mixing different types of lighting can create a layered effect and make the kitchen feel more inviting.

3. How can I incorporate natural elements like wood and stone to add to the rustic feel of my farmhouse kitchen?

Adding natural elements like wood and stone can enhance the rustic charm of a farmhouse kitchen. I like to use reclaimed wood for my kitchen cabinets or open shelves to bring a sense of history and texture to the space. Stone countertops or a farmhouse sink can also add a touch of authenticity and warmth. These natural materials can help create a cozy, lived-in feel that is quintessential to a moody farmhouse kitchen.

4. What kind of textiles and fabrics can I use to make my kitchen feel more comfortable and cozy?

To make my farmhouse kitchen feel more comfortable and cozy, I like to incorporate soft textiles and fabrics. Plush rugs or runner carpets can add warmth and softness underfoot. I also like to use linen or cotton curtains to soften the windows and add a touch of elegance. Adding throw pillows or seat cushions in natural textures like burlap or wool can make the kitchen feel more inviting and cozy.

5. Are there any specific decor items or accessories that can enhance the moody farmhouse vibe in my kitchen?

To enhance the moody farmhouse vibe in my kitchen, I like to incorporate vintage and antique decor items. Old wooden crates, vintage signs, or rustic metal accents can add character and charm to the space. I also like to display handmade pottery or woven baskets to bring a sense of craftsmanship and authenticity to the kitchen. These decor items can help create a cozy, lived-in look that is perfect for a farmhouse kitchen.

6. How can I optimize the layout and design of my kitchen to maximize its coziness and functionality?

Optimizing the layout and design of my farmhouse kitchen is essential to creating a cozy and functional space. I like to keep the layout open and airy to allow for easy movement and flow. Creating designated zones for cooking, dining, and gathering can help maximize the functionality of the space. I also like to incorporate ample storage solutions like pantry cabinets or floating shelves to keep the kitchen organized and clutter-free.

7. Are there any DIY projects or easy updates I can do to transform my farmhouse kitchen into a cozy haven?

Transforming my farmhouse kitchen into a cozy haven doesn’t have to be complicated. Simple DIY projects like painting the cabinets in a warm, inviting color or installing a new backsplash with natural stone tiles can make a big impact. Adding floating shelves for displaying decor items or creating a cozy breakfast nook with a built-in bench can also enhance the coziness of the space. Small updates and personal touches can go a long way in transforming a moody farmhouse kitchen into a cozy retreat.

12 Unique Ideas to Create a Cozy Atmosphere in Your Moody Farmhouse Kitchen

moody farmhouse kitchen

When it comes to transforming your farmhouse kitchen into a warm and inviting space, there are several unique ideas you can consider. From choosing the right paint colors to incorporating rustic elements, here are 12 tips to help you create a cozy atmosphere in your moody farmhouse kitchen:

1. **Warm Paint Colors:** Opt for paint colors like Sherwin Williams’ “Warm Stone” or Benjamin Moore’s “Hale Navy” to add a touch of warmth to your kitchen walls.

2. **Vintage Lighting:** Install vintage-inspired light fixtures or pendant lights to create a cozy ambiance in your kitchen.

3. **Wooden Accents:** Incorporate wooden elements such as open shelves, bar stools, or a farmhouse table to bring a rustic charm to your kitchen.

4. **Soft Textiles:** Add soft textiles like a plush rug, curtains, or chair cushions in warm tones to enhance the cozy feel of your kitchen.

5. **Organized Storage:** Invest in storage solutions like pantry organizers or hanging racks to keep your kitchen clutter-free and organized.

6. **Personal Touches:** Display family photos, artwork, or sentimental objects to personalize your kitchen and make it feel more welcoming.

7. **Farmhouse Sink:** Consider installing a farmhouse sink with a vintage-inspired faucet to add character to your kitchen.

8. **Herb Garden:** Create a small herb garden in your kitchen window or on a countertop to bring a touch of greenery and freshness to the space.

9. **Mason Jar Decor:** Use mason jars as decorative accents for storing utensils, spices, or displaying flowers in your farmhouse kitchen.

10. **Vintage Cookware:** Display vintage cookware or kitchen accessories on open shelves or as wall decor to add a nostalgic touch to your kitchen.

11. **Cozy Seating Area:** Create a cozy seating nook with a bench or armchairs where you can relax and enjoy a cup of coffee or read a book.

12. **Copper Accents:** Incorporate copper accents like pots, pans, or utensils to add warmth and a touch of luxury to your farmhouse kitchen.

By incorporating these unique ideas and paying attention to details like paint colors, lighting, and decor elements, you can create a cozy atmosphere in your moody farmhouse kitchen that is both stylish and inviting.
